The Research to Practice Gap
In this episode of The Research to Practice Gap, Dr. Helen Flores sits down with educator and leadership coach Michael Fairbanks II to discuss one of education’s biggest challenges: teacher retention. Drawing from his experiences as a teacher, principal, and instructional leader, Michael shares practical strategies for sustaining intrinsic motivation, building mental flexibility, and creating systems that help educators stay in the profession longer. From knowing your community to rehearsing lessons and “starting over every day,” this conversation offers honest, actionable insights for both new and veteran teachers navigating the realities of today’s classrooms.
